Derbyshire Man Posted December 6, 2024 Share #2 Posted December 6, 2024 I've not had mine that long, the M11P for 12 months or so. The first one I had was plagued with a randomly sticky rangefinder. It did it initially for a day and then stopped, it repeated it again 6 months later when I was on a trip. Again only for a short time. I was offered it being sent off (for aeons) or a swap for a demo. I was told the demo was mint. When I got it home and examined it in different lighting it actually had two wear marks from zips on the top plate. I thought about taking it back but couldn't be bothered. Over the next 6 months these have largely disappeared so excellent I'd say! Of course it is possible to 'aluminium' the edges/scratch the coating on the rangefinder and generally wear it all sorts of ways but overall the coating is very hard. 1 1 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
